Joint Air Defense Systems Integrator JADSI AN/TSQ-214 (V1A) system

Synopsis is for establishing a contract modification to existing contract FA8523-12-D-0003 to Ultra Electronics Inc (cage code 0B9D8) located in Austin TX.  This contract is for Contractor Logistics Support of the Joint Air Defense Systems Integrator (JADSI) AN/TSQ-214(V1A) system.  The Government contemplates extending the period of performance for this contract under the extension of services clause (FAR 52.217-8) Option to Extend Services clause which will allow for up to six months of services under referenced contract above.   There are no specifications, plans or drawings available to be provided by the Government for this effort.  A letter request for solicitation will be issued electronically but will not be posted to Fed Biz Ops.  The estimated solicitation issuance date will be 1 Sept 2017 with a response of 15 Sept 2017.  Authority:  10 U.S.C. 2304(c)(1) Justification for supplies or services required are available from only one or a limited number of responsible sources and no other type of supplies or services will satisfy agency requirements.  Point of contact is Contracting Officer Lenora Pinkett, Telephone 478-926-7443 or email Lenora.pinkett@us.af.mil to communicate concerns regarding this acquisition.   If your concerns are not satisfied by the contracting officer, an Ombudsman has been appointed to hear contracts that are not resolved through established channels.  The purposes of the Ombudsman is not to diminish the authority of the program director or contracting officer, but to communicate contractor concerns, issues, disagreements and recommendations to the appropriate Government personnel.  When requested, the Ombudsman will maintain strict confidentiality as to the source of the concern.  The Ombudsman does not participate in the evaluation of the proposals in the source selection process.  When appropriate, potential offerors may contact Ombudsman Kimberly McDonald, Chief, Contracting Policy Division at 478-222-1088.  FedBizOps numbered notes 22 and 26 apply.
